On this episode of Born or Made, Larry sits down with Jordan and Jon Berens, the visionary brothers behind Kaizen Wellness, to explore how small, continuous improvements can lead to massive transformation in business, health, and life.After leaving behind the corporate grind and embarking on a life-changing journey to Japan, Jordan and Jon immersed themselves in the teachings of mountain monks, practicing meditation, Tai Chi, and holistic wellness. What they discovered was a timeless philosophy—Kaizen—the idea that true success comes from daily, intentional progress.Now, through Kaizen Wellness, they merge ancient wisdom with modern science, creating products designed to fuel the mind, body, and spirit. In this episode, they share:🔹 The Kaizen mindset and why small improvements lead to exponential growth🔹 How holistic wellness fuels high performance in business and life🔹 What living with monks taught them about discipline, purpose, and fulfillment🔹 The role of rituals, mindset, and environment in shaping successIf you’re looking for a real, sustainable way to improve your life and business, this episode will change how you approach growth, wellness, and success.
